墨雨

“Ink Rain”

His Story

A boy of Baoyu’s outer study. The novel gives him one thing: in the schoolroom brawl of Chapter 9 he snatches up a door-bar and charges in with the others, and that is the last of him. His name, ink rain, is of a piece with the rest of the set — Tealeaf, sweeping the red, hoeing the herbs — names taken from a study desk and hung on children.

In Xiang Li's Hands

Frowning straight out at us, both fists closed round a wooden shaft held across the body, in a green-grey jacket and a long red sash. Two cats are washed in grey behind him and a third sits pale at his feet. The stance is combative; the sheet is full of cats.

The Calligraphy

Inscribed 墨雨 in the top left, the wetter of the two characters brushed with the ink pooling — the name written in the substance it names.
